if you really are smart, you would inoculate your compost pile with edible
mushrooms, then you would get
- readily available nutrients thanks to the mushrooms and
- and extra veggie.
i have done so with the wood chips in my asparagus bed. results next year,
but i already have a shiitake-inoculated log which is great.
